d. Plug the power cord back into the power source.
e. If the power source is DC, plug the input cable back into the power supply.
CAUTION
Do not power cycle the satellite router by unplugging the power cord from the
router's rear panel. Doing so could result in static electricity discharge that could
shock you and/or damage the router.
7. Check the Web Acceleration Status field again.
If Web Acceleration is still not operational, contact your service provider for
assistance.
